vocation without a gift and the gift without calling

Georges Bernanos, French Catholic writer, said: "Every vocation is a calling." The Dictionary of Authorities, which was the first of the Royal Academy in 1726, defined as "the inspiration that God calls a state of perfection." It was, of course, a generalization from religious vocations. Fitness, as the same dictionary, is "the ability and ease and way to do something." Two and a half centuries later, the Dictionary of the Royal Academy retains these definitions with minimal retouching. What it says is that a clear vocation and assumed depth becomes insatiable, eternal, and resistant to any opposing force: the only provision of the spirit can defeat love.

The skills are often accompanied by physical attributes. If they are singing the same musical note several children, about the exact repeat, some do not. Music teachers say the first they have what is called the primary ear, which is important for musicians. Antonio Sarasate, four years, came with his violin toy a note that his father, a great virtuoso, he could not find yours. Whenever there is a risk, however, that adults kill such virtues because they do not seem paramount, and end up typecast their children in the reality that parents walled them in boxes. The rigor of many parents with children is often the same artists dealing with gay children.

The skills and vocations do not always come together. Hence the disaster sublime voices of singers who do not go anywhere because of lack of trial, or painters who sacrificed a lifetime to a profession wrong, or prolific writers who have nothing to say. Only when the two come together there is a chance of something happening, but not by magic, still lack the discipline, study, technique and power to overcome for a lifetime. For the narrators

What eat the letters?

Colombians, has always seen us as a country of lawyers. Perhaps this is due to the high school programs do more emphasis on literature in the other arts. But apart from the chronological memory of authors and works, the students are not cultivated the habit of reading, but force them to read and do synopsis books written programmed. Everywhere I meet professionals scalded by the books they forced to read in school with the same pleasure with which they drank castor oil. For synopsis, unfortunately, had no problems, because ads found in newspapers like this: "Change synopsis of Don Quixote by synopsis of The Odyssey." That's right: in Colombia there is a market so prosperous and so intense traffic photostatic summaries that we put together best business writers do not write the original books but once writing the synopses for high school. Is this method of teaching rather than television and bad books, "which is destroying the habit reading. I agree that good literature course can only be a gem for readers. But it is impossible for children to read a novel, write synopsis and prepare a reflective statement for the following Tuesday. Ideally, a child devote part of their weekend to read a book as far as possible and as far as you like, which is the only condition to read a book, but it is criminal, for himself and for the book, which read to the force in your hours of play and with the anguish of the other tasks.

would take "as needed even for all the arts-a special band with high school literature classes that only pretend to be smart guides reading and reflection to become good readers. For train writers is another story. No one taught to write, but good books, read with the aptitude and vocation alerts. Work experience is how little an established writer can convey to the trainees if they still have a minimum of humility to believe that someone may know more than them. For that we would not need a college, but practical and participative workshops, where craftsmen writers discuss with students the carpentry trade: how they took their arguments, how they imagined their characters, how they solved their technical problems of structure, style, tone, which is the only individual that can sometimes drawn in clean great mystery of creation. The same set of workshops is already proven for some genres of journalism, film and television, and in particular stories and screenplays. And without tests or qualifications or anything. That life decide who serves and who does not work, as happens anyway.
